Friday afternoon microblogging round-up

May 8, 2009 By Dan Thornton

All the things I haven’t managed to cram into the week:

Rania Al Abdullah, Queen of Jordan joins Twitter – and gets it:

Nice to see even royalty are getting in on microblogging.

Accessible Twitter makes the Twitter website meets accessibility requirements:

It’s easy to forget how important accessibility requirements are for so many internet users – including all of us as we age!

Interesting look at whether any of the myriad of Twitter-based enterprises can turn a profit:

It’s quite a good overview of a handful of the more promising/interesting Twitter-based attempts to make money – would be better with some added interviews/insight/figures on how the companies are actually doing – which is an area I want to explore more with 140Char.

Roadtwip:

Follow some friends (including ReadWriteWeb contributor Jolie O’Dell) as they roadtrip through 10 cities and 10 social media events..some fun inspiration to end Friday with.
